Lion girls survive four-set struggle versus Lanesboro

October 16, 2022 by Lee Epps

Spring Grove Lions Volleyball
Spring Grove Lions Volleyball
Katelyn Kraus (4) and Joelle Halverson (16) attempt to block an attack of Lanesboro’s Kaci Ruen.
Photo by Lee Epps

Trailing Lanesboro 20-16 in the fourth set, state-ranked No. 9 Spring Grove avoided a fifth set by winning 9 of the final 11 points to win the match, 3-1 (22-25, 25-22, 25-19, 25-22) and complete a season sweep of the Burros. It was exciting with three 25-22 set scores, but it was an inconsistent evening for both teams. It was a rare occasion in which the team with the most kills and most ace serves did not win the match. The Oct. 3 outcome was decided by errors, and the Lions prevailed by making fewer mistakes. Lanesboro outscored SG 56-52 with winning plays (kills, blocks, ace serves), but the visiting Burros also gave away 15 more error points, including 18 ball-handling miscues. Second-place Spring Grove improved to 18-3 and 9-1 in the SEC East Division. Third-place Lanesboro slipped to 11-12-1 and 6-4 in the division.

One exception to inconsistency was the Lions’ closing 9-to-2 run with three kills on five attacks plus a pair of ace serves. The Burros had looked best with a great five-kill, two-ace rally that fell just short in the second set. Trailing 22-14, Lanesboro scored eight of the next 10 points to get back within two points at 24-22 before falling 25-22.

For SG, Addyson McHugh scored with 15 kills, 2 blocks and 2 ace serves. Kenadee Gerard put away 11 kills along with 2 ace serves. Maggie Lile served 21 for 21 with 2 aces. Kendal VanMinsel served 2 aces on only a dozen serves (12 for 12).

Lanesboro’s Kaci Ruen had 19 kills, 5 ace serves and 17 digs. Jessie Schreiber added 9 kills and 24 digs. Jensyn Storhoff contributed 5 kills, 10 set assists and16 digs.

Set one (LHS wins 25-22) was tied nine times, last at 20-20, before the Burros prevailed with a kill and a final ace serve along with

three Lion errors.

Set two (SG wins 25-22) saw SG lead most of the way, by as many as eight points before the Burros best stretch of play go them back within two points at 24-2.2.

Set three (SG wins 25-19) was the only one that did not go down to the wire, but it was tied at 16-16 before six kills (five by McHugh) gave SG a 2-sets-to-1 lead in the match.

Set four (SG wins 25-2) saw the Lions lead early by as many as five points before the Burros rallied to lead 20-16. A fifth set appeared imminent, but there were no SG errors through the final 11 points. Tied at 22-all, a Burro ball-handling error and a pair of McHugh kills ended the hard-fought match.

The Lion B-team (10-0) also completed a season sweep of Lanesboro 2-0 (25-9, 25-15). The C-team (7-2) did as well but needed a third set in this rematch, 2-1 (24-26, 25-18, 25-10).
